Acne is considered to
be a problem of the adolescence. It affects teenagers mostly because
it is primarily caused by hormonal imbalance, which occurs during the
growing up years. However, this does not mean that the grown ups are
immune to the problem. Men and women of all ages are susceptible to
the problem. The basic fact is that it can catch up with amazing
swiftness to even those who reach the age of 40, or more.
Acne In Men
Among men, there are a number of
factors that can cause acne. Excessive secretion of oil and clogged
pores are the basic cause of acne. Those who have oily skin are prone
to the problem. So, if you have oily skin and your job demands you to
stay in dusty environment, the likelihood of your developing acne
problem is heightened manifold irrespective of age.
A
substandard shaving cream may also cause acne. The same goes for
after shave lotions. So, you need to take care of a few things. Use a
fresh, good quality blade every time you shave, and use a good
shaving cream.
Another cause of acne
is stress. The hectic lives we lead today bring stress as a
byproduct. This could be a reason for your acne. This does not mean
that stress necessarily causes acne. Whether or not the stress would
cause acne depends upon whether or not your skin is prone to acne.
You have to be extra careful if you have been a teenager with the
extended period of acne problem or you suffered from severe acne
during your growing up years.
Acne In Women
So far as women are concerned, they are
prone to acne at all those stages where they undergo hormonal
changes. Acne, therefore, is likely to breakout during pregnancy and
around the time of menopause because during these stages hormonal
levels fluctuate.
Therefore, it is prudent that the women who are
prone to acne prepare themselves beforehand by arming themselves with
information and medical advice before the pregnancy and menopause.
Acne, therefore, is not simply a
teenager’s problem. It might affect the elders too. Thus, it is
important that you are prepared and not taken by surprise when acne
breaks out.
